Ganti Semua Aplikasi Produktivitas Anda! Coba Taskwarrior Berbasis Terminal

Oleh VOXBLICK

Jumat, 21 November 2025 - 09.45 WIB
Ganti Semua Aplikasi Produktivitas Anda! Coba Taskwarrior Berbasis Terminal
Taskwarrior, produktivitas di terminal (Foto oleh Ivan S)

VOXBLICK.COM - Dalam lanskap digital yang kian ramai, janji akan produktivitas tanpa batas seringkali justru berujung pada kebingungan. Kita dibanjiri oleh aplikasi manajemen tugas, kalender, dan pencatat yang saling bersaing, masing-masing dengan antarmuka yang memukau dan fitur yang tumpang tindih. Hasilnya? Lebih banyak waktu dihabiskan untuk mengelola aplikasi daripada menyelesaikan tugas itu sendiri. Namun, bagaimana jika ada cara untuk memotong semua kerumitan itu, kembali ke esensi manajemen tugas, dan menemukan efisiensi yang tak tertandingi? Perkenalkan Taskwarrior: sebuah aplikasi manajemen tugas berbasis terminal yang revolusioner, dirancang untuk menyederhanakan alur kerja Anda dan meningkatkan efisiensi ke tingkat yang baru.

Ulasan praktis ini akan membawa Anda menyelami Taskwarrior, sebuah alat CLI (Command Line Interface) yang mungkin terlihat intimidatif pada pandangan pertama, namun menyimpan kekuatan luar biasa.

Kami akan membahas fitur utama, cara penggunaan, dan mengapa ia berpotensi besar untuk menggantikan semua aplikasi produktivitas grafis Anda yang haus sumber daya. Siap untuk mengubah cara Anda bekerja?

Apa Itu Taskwarrior? Filosofi di Balik Kesederhanaan

Taskwarrior bukanlah sekadar aplikasi manajemen tugas biasa. Ini adalah filosofi. Dikembangkan dengan prinsip kesederhanaan, kecepatan, dan kontrol penuh, Taskwarrior memungkinkan Anda mengelola tugas langsung dari baris perintah terminal.

Tidak ada antarmuka grafis yang memakan RAM, tidak ada sinkronisasi cloud yang mencurigakan secara default, dan tidak ada fitur yang tidak perlu. Yang ada hanyalah alat yang fokus pada satu hal: membantu Anda menyelesaikan pekerjaan.

Inti dari Taskwarrior adalah kemampuannya untuk beradaptasi. Berbeda dengan aplikasi lain yang memaksakan alur kerja tertentu, Taskwarrior memberikan fondasi yang kuat, dan Anda, sebagai pengguna, bebas membentuknya sesuai kebutuhan Anda.

Ini adalah solusi bagi para profesional, pengembang, penulis, atau siapa pun yang mendambakan kontrol penuh atas daftar tugas mereka tanpa gangguan visual yang tidak perlu.

Ganti Semua Aplikasi Produktivitas Anda! Coba Taskwarrior Berbasis Terminal
Ganti Semua Aplikasi Produktivitas Anda! Coba Taskwarrior Berbasis Terminal (Foto oleh Thibault Luycx)

Mengapa Beralih ke Terminal? Kekuatan CLI untuk Produktivitas

Mungkin pertanyaan pertama yang muncul adalah: "Mengapa harus menggunakan terminal di era aplikasi GUI yang begitu canggih?" Jawabannya terletak pada efisiensi dan kontrol.

Aplikasi berbasis CLI seperti Taskwarrior menawarkan beberapa keunggulan signifikan:

  • Kecepatan Maksimal: Menambahkan, mencari, atau menandai tugas selesai dapat dilakukan dalam hitungan detik dengan beberapa ketukan tombol, tanpa perlu menyentuh mouse atau menavigasi menu.
  • Ringan & Hemat Sumber Daya: Tanpa antarmuka grafis yang berat, Taskwarrior mengonsumsi sumber daya sistem yang sangat minim, menjadikannya pilihan ideal bahkan untuk perangkat keras lama atau saat Anda ingin menjaga fokus tanpa beban tambahan pada CPU/RAM.
  • Kustomisasi Tanpa Batas: Dengan konfigurasi file teks sederhana dan sistem hooks, Anda dapat menyesuaikan setiap aspek Taskwarrior, mulai dari format tampilan tugas hingga perilaku otomatis.
  • Fokus Tanpa Gangguan: Tidak ada ikon berwarna-warni, notifikasi pop-up yang mengganggu, atau elemen visual yang berebut perhatian Anda. Hanya Anda dan daftar tugas yang perlu diselesaikan.
  • Privasi Data: Secara default, data Anda disimpan secara lokal di komputer Anda, memberikan Anda kontrol penuh atas informasi sensitif Anda.

Fitur Utama Taskwarrior yang Membuatnya Unggul

Meskipun berbasis terminal, Taskwarrior jauh dari kata sederhana dalam hal fungsionalitas. Berikut adalah beberapa fitur utama yang membuatnya menjadi alat manajemen tugas yang sangat kuat:

  • Sintaksis Sederhana namun Kuat: Menambahkan tugas semudah task add "Tulis artikel Taskwarrior". Anda dapat menambahkan atribut seperti proyek, tag, prioritas, atau tanggal jatuh tempo dengan mudah: task add "Kirim laporan bulanan" project:finansial due:tomorrow pri:H +urgent.
  • Tag, Proyek, & Prioritas: Atur tugas Anda dengan tag (+work, +home), proyek (project:website), dan tingkat prioritas (pri:H, pri:M, pri:L) untuk kategorisasi dan penyaringan yang efektif.
  • Pencarian & Pelaporan Fleksibel: Temukan tugas spesifik dengan filter yang kuat (misalnya, task project:website status:pending) dan hasilkan laporan kustom (misalnya, task burndown.daily) untuk melacak kemajuan Anda.
  • UDA (User Defined Attributes): Perlu melacak nomor tiket atau URL terkait? Buat atribut kustom Anda sendiri untuk menambahkan detail unik ke setiap tugas.
  • Sinkronisasi (Taskd): Untuk pengguna yang membutuhkan sinkronisasi antar perangkat, Taskwarrior menyediakan server sinkronisasi bernama Taskd. Ini adalah solusi mandiri yang dapat Anda host sendiri, memberikan privasi dan kontrol maksimal.
  • Ekstensibilitas dengan Hooks: Taskwarrior mendukung hooks, skrip yang dapat dieksekusi sebelum atau sesudah perintah tertentu, memungkinkan otomatisasi dan integrasi dengan alat lain.

Memulai dengan Taskwarrior: Panduan Praktis

Menginstal dan menggunakan Taskwarrior sangat mudah. Berikut adalah langkah-langkah dasarnya:

Instalasi

Di sebagian besar sistem operasi Linux, Anda bisa menginstalnya melalui manajer paket:

sudo apt install task
# Atau di Fedora/RHEL
sudo dnf install taskwarrior
# Atau di macOS dengan Homebrew
brew install task

Perintah Dasar

  • Menambahkan Tugas:
    task add "Beli susu dan roti"
    task add "Revisi proposal" project:klien_a due:2024-07-30 pri:H +penting
  • Melihat Tugas:
    task list (Menampilkan semua tugas yang pending)
    task next (Menampilkan tugas yang paling relevan)
    task project:klien_a list (Menampilkan tugas untuk proyek tertentu)
  • Menandai Selesai:
    Setiap tugas memiliki ID. Anda bisa melihatnya dengan task list. Misal, ID 1.
    task 1 done
  • Mengubah Tugas:
    task 1 modify "Beli susu, roti, dan telur"
    task 1 modify due:tomorrow
  • Menghapus Tugas:
    task 1 delete (Akan meminta konfirmasi)
  • Melihat Detail Tugas:
    task 1 info

Contoh Alur Kerja Nyata

Bayangkan Anda memulai hari kerja. Anda membuka terminal, ketik task next untuk melihat prioritas utama Anda. Setelah menyelesaikan salah satu tugas, Anda langsung menandainya selesai dengan task ID_tugas done. Anda perlu menambahkan tugas baru yang mendesak? Cukup task add "Telepon Pak Budi" +urgent due:eod. Semua ini dilakukan tanpa perlu berpindah aplikasi, memecah fokus, atau menunggu antarmuka grafis dimuat.

Membandingkan Taskwarrior dengan Aplikasi Produktivitas Lain

Bagaimana Taskwarrior bersaing dengan raksasa produktivitas seperti Todoist, Trello, atau Notion?

  • Vs. Aplikasi GUI (Todoist, Trello, Asana): Taskwarrior menang dalam hal kecepatan, privasi, dan kustomisasi mendalam. Aplikasi GUI cenderung lebih ramah pengguna awal dan menawarkan kolaborasi yang lebih mudah, tetapi seringkali datang dengan biaya langganan, konsumsi sumber daya yang lebih tinggi, dan ketergantungan pada server pihak ketiga. Taskwarrior adalah pilihan bagi mereka yang mengutamakan kontrol dan efisiensi personal.
  • Vs. Aplikasi CLI Sederhana (Todo.txt): Sementara Todo.txt sangat minimalis dan berbasis file teks, Taskwarrior menawarkan fitur yang lebih canggih seperti pelaporan, UDA, dan sistem sinkronisasi Taskd yang terintegrasi, menjadikannya pilihan yang lebih kuat untuk manajemen tugas yang kompleks tanpa kehilangan fleksibilitas CLI.

Manfaat Jangka Panjang: Mengapa Ini Layak Dicoba

Mengadopsi Taskwarrior berarti menginvestasikan waktu untuk mempelajari alat baru, namun imbalannya sangat besar:

  • Fokus Tanpa Gangguan: Dengan meminimalkan visual dan interaksi yang tidak perlu, Anda dapat benar-benar fokus pada tugas Anda.
  • Kontrol Penuh: Anda adalah penguasa data dan alur kerja Anda. Tidak ada algoritma yang memutuskan apa yang harus Anda lihat.
  • Efisiensi Maksimal: Kecepatan input dan manipulasi tugas melalui CLI akan menghemat waktu Anda secara signifikan dalam jangka panjang.
  • Privasi Data Terjamin: Data Anda tetap di perangkat Anda, atau di server Taskd yang Anda kelola sendiri.
  • Fleksibilitas Adaptif: Taskwarrior dapat disesuaikan untuk cocok dengan hampir semua metodologi manajemen tugas, dari GTD (Getting Things Done) hingga Kanban pribadi.

Taskwarrior adalah lebih dari sekadar aplikasi ini adalah perubahan paradigma dalam bagaimana Anda mendekati produktivitas. Ini menantang gagasan bahwa semakin banyak fitur dan antarmuka yang menarik berarti semakin baik.

Sebaliknya, ia membuktikan bahwa kekuatan sejati terletak pada kesederhanaan, kontrol, dan efisiensi yang tanpa kompromi. Jika Anda lelah dengan hiruk pikuk aplikasi produktivitas yang ada, dan mencari alat yang solid, cepat, dan sepenuhnya milik Anda, maka inilah saatnya untuk mencoba Taskwarrior. Berikan kesempatan pada terminal Anda untuk menjadi pusat produktivitas Anda, dan Anda mungkin akan terkejut betapa banyak yang bisa Anda capai.

Apa Reaksi Anda?

Suka Suka 0
Tidak Suka Tidak Suka 0
Cinta Cinta 0
Lucu Lucu 0
Marah Marah 0
Sedih Sedih 0
Wow Wow 0